How do I encourage my dog to play?

Are you worried that your dog seems uninterested in playing and you want to find ways to encourage them to be more active? Playing is an essential part of a dog's life as it helps them stay mentally and physically healthy, so it's important to find ways to engage them in playtime. In this article, we will discuss some effective ways to encourage your dog to play and have fun.

First and foremost, it's important to understand your dog's preferences and personality. Just like humans, dogs have individual likes and dislikes when it comes to play. Some dogs may prefer toys that involve fetching, while others may enjoy tug-of-war games or chasing a ball. By observing your dog's behavior and reactions to different types of toys and activities, you can tailor their playtime to suit their interests.

Another way to encourage your dog to play is by creating a fun and stimulating environment. Make sure your dog has access to a variety of toys and playthings to keep them entertained. Rotate their toys regularly to prevent boredom and novelty. You can also set up obstacle courses or interactive games that challenge your dog's problem-solving skills and keep them engaged. Additionally, consider taking your dog to new and exciting outdoor locations for playtime, such as the park or a dog-friendly beach.

It's also important to schedule regular playtime with your dog. Dogs thrive on routine and structure, so setting aside dedicated play sessions each day can help reinforce the bond between you and your furry friend. Make playtime a positive and rewarding experience by using treats, praise, and affection to encourage your dog's participation. Remember to keep play sessions short and engaging to prevent your dog from getting bored or tired.

Furthermore, consider enrolling your dog in agility or obedience training classes to stimulate their mind and body through structured play. These classes not only provide mental and physical exercise but also help strengthen the bond between you and your dog. Additionally, socializing your dog with other pets and people through playdates or visits to the dog park can help them develop social skills and confidence.

In conclusion, encouraging your dog to play is essential for their overall well-being and happiness. By understanding your dog's preferences, creating a stimulating environment, scheduling regular playtime, and engaging in structured play activities, you can keep your dog active and entertained. Remember to be patient and persistent in finding what works best for your dog, and most importantly, have fun and enjoy the precious moments of playtime with your furry companion.
